What is Record Dividends per Share?

Record's dividends per share for the six months ended in Sep. 2023 was £0.03. Its dividends per share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 was £0.05. Its Dividend Payout Ratio for the six months ended in Sep. 2023 was 1.04. As of today, Record's Dividend Yield % is 7.42%.

During the past 12 months, Record's average Dividends Per Share Growth Rate was 27.80%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Dividends Per Share Growth Rate was 19.20%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Dividends Per Share Growth Rate was 10.30% per year. During the past 10 years, the average Dividends Per Share Growth Rate was 10.70% per year. Record  (LSE:REC) Dividends per Share Explanation

1. Dividend Payout Ratio measures the percentage of the company's earnings paid out as dividends.

Record's Dividend Payout Ratio for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is calculated as

Dividend Payout Ratio=Dividends per Share (Q: Sep. 2023 )/ EPS without NRI (Q: Sep. 2023 )
=0.025/ 0.024
=1.04

During the past 13 years, the highest Dividend Payout Ratio of Record was 0.92. The lowest was 0.56. And the median was 0.69.

Record PLC is a United Kingdom-based company currency management firm. The company provides services to clients such as pension funds, charities, foundations, endowments, and family offices, as well as other fund managers and corporate entities. Geographically, it derives a majority of revenue from Switzerland and also has a presence in the United Kingdom, United States, and Other Countries. Revenue comprises of mainly management fees, and performance fees. Its services include Core Passive Hedging, Tenor Management, Dynamic Hedging, Signal Hedging, Asset-Backed Hedging, Cross Currency Liquidity, Liquidity Management, and others.
